here is the java file that produces the error “08-02 19:17:22.265: E/AndroidRuntime(17817): java.lang.ClassCastException: android.widget.RelativeLayout cannot be cast to android.widget.TextView”

 package tip.calculator;


import android.os.Bundle;
import android.app.Activity;
import android.text.TextUtils;
import android.view.View.OnClickListener;
import android.widget.EditText;
import android.widget.TextView;
import android.widget.Toast;
import android.view.View;
import android.widget.Button;




public class TipCalculator extends Activity 
{

private Button enter;
EditText myEditField ;
EditText myEditField2;
float percentage = 0;
float percentageInp = 0;
float billAmount = 0;
double output = 0; 
String output1 = "";
Button clearButton ;
TextView textView;

public void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) {
    super.onCreate(savedInstanceState);
    setContentView(R.layout.activity_main);

    myEditField = (EditText) findViewById(R.id.percentText);
    enter = (Button)findViewById(R.id.button1);
    myEditField2 = (EditText) findViewById(R.id.billText);
    clearButton = (Button) findViewById(R.id.clearButton);


    enter.setOnClickListener(new OnClickListener() {


        public void onClick(View v) {

             TextView errors;
             textView = (TextView) findViewById(R.id.textView1);
             errors = (TextView) findViewById(R.id.errorText);    



             if((myEditField2 != null) && (!TextUtils.isEmpty(myEditField2.getText().toString()))){


                percentageInp = Float.parseFloat(myEditField.getText().toString());
                billAmount = Float.parseFloat(myEditField2.getText().toString());

                percentage = ((float)percentageInp /100);

                output = (double)(billAmount * percentage);

                double result = output * 100;
                result = Math.round(result);
                result = result / 100;

                output1 = Double.toString(result);

                textView.setText(output1 + " $");

             } else{
                //Toast.makeToast(.....).show(); //Inform user about the error
             }

        }
    });

    clearButton.setOnClickListener(new OnClickListener() {

        public void onClick(View arg0) {

            percentage = 0;
            output = 0;
            output1 = "";

            TextView textView = (TextView)findViewById(R.id.errorText);
            textView.setText("");

            TextView textView2 = (TextView)findViewById(R.id.percentText);
            textView2.setText("");

            TextView textView3 = (TextView)findViewById(R.id.billText);
            textView3.setText("");


            TextView textView1 = (TextView)findViewById(R.id.textView1);
            textView1.setText("");


            percentageInp = 0;
            billAmount = 0;

            myEditField.clearComposingText();
            myEditField2.clearComposingText();

        }


    });
}
}

here is the logcat error that i don’t understand why it occurs…

08-02 19:17:22.265: E/AndroidRuntime(17817): java.lang.ClassCastException: android.widget.RelativeLayout cannot be cast to android.widget.TextView
08-02 19:17:22.265: E/AndroidRuntime(17817):    at tip.calculator.TipCalculator$1.onClick(TipCalculator.java:48)
08-02 19:17:22.265: E/AndroidRuntime(17817):    at android.view.View.performClick(View.java:3620)
08-02 19:17:22.265: E/AndroidRuntime(17817):    at android.view.View$PerformClick.run(View.java:14292)
08-02 19:17:22.265: E/AndroidRuntime(17817):    at android.os.Handler.handleCallback(Handler.java:605)
08-02 19:17:22.265: E/AndroidRuntime(17817):    at android.os.Handler.dispatchMessage(Handler.java:92)
08-02 19:17:22.265: E/AndroidRuntime(17817):    at android.os.Looper.loop(Looper.java:137)
08-02 19:17:22.265: E/AndroidRuntime(17817):    at android.app.ActivityThread.main(ActivityThread.java:4507)
08-02 19:17:22.265: E/AndroidRuntime(17817):    at java.lang.reflect.Method.invokeNative(Native Method)
08-02 19:17:22.265: E/AndroidRuntime(17817):    at java.lang.reflect.Method.invoke(Method.java:511)
08-02 19:17:22.265: E/AndroidRuntime(17817):    at com.android.internal.os.ZygoteInit$MethodAndArgsCaller.run(ZygoteInit.java:790)
08-02 19:17:22.265: E/AndroidRuntime(17817):    at com.android.internal.os.ZygoteInit.main(ZygoteInit.java:557)
08-02 19:17:22.265: E/AndroidRuntime(17817):    at dalvik.system.NativeStart.main(Native Method)

here is the xml with all the textViews and such sorry took a while…

<RelativeLayout x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android"
    xmlns:tools="http://schemas.android.com/tools"
    android:id="@+id/errorText"
    android:layout_width="match_parent"
    android:layout_height="match_parent"
    android:onClick="onEnterClick" >

    <EditText
        android:id="@+id/billText"
        android:layout_width="wrap_content"
        android:layout_height="wrap_content"
        android:layout_centerHorizontal="true"
        android:ems="10"
        android:hint="Bill Amount"
         android:inputType="numberDecimal"
        android:singleLine="true" />

    <EditText
        android:id="@+id/percentText"
        android:layout_width="wrap_content"
        android:layout_height="wrap_content"
        android:layout_alignLeft="@+id/billText"
        android:layout_below="@+id/billText"
        android:ems="10"
        android:hint="Percent"
        android:inputType="number"
        android:singleLine="true" >

        <requestFocus />
    </EditText>

    <Button
        android:id="@+id/button1"
        android:layout_width="wrap_content"
        android:layout_height="wrap_content"
        android:layout_below="@+id/percentText"
        android:layout_centerHorizontal="true"
        android:text="Calculate" />

    <TextView
        android:id="@+id/textView2"
        android:layout_width="wrap_content"
        android:layout_height="wrap_content"
        android:layout_above="@+id/percentText"
        android:layout_toRightOf="@+id/billText"
        android:text="$"
        android:textAppearance="?android:attr/textAppearanceLarge" />

    <TextView
        android:id="@+id/textView3"
        android:layout_width="wrap_content"
        android:layout_height="wrap_content"
        android:layout_alignBottom="@+id/percentText"
        android:layout_alignLeft="@+id/textView2"
        android:text="%"
        android:textAppearance="?android:attr/textAppearanceLarge" />

    <Button
        android:id="@+id/clearButton"
        android:layout_width="wrap_content"
        android:layout_height="wrap_content"
        android:layout_below="@+id/button1"
        android:layout_centerHorizontal="true"
        android:text="Clear" />

    <TextView
        android:id="@+id/textView1"
        android:layout_width="wrap_content"
        android:layout_height="wrap_content"
        android:layout_alignRight="@+id/textView3"
        android:layout_below="@+id/clearButton"
        android:text="Solution Will Appear Here"
        android:textAppearance="?android:attr/textAppearanceLarge" />

</RelativeLayout>
